Spectacular Jumping Crocodile Cruise
On a Spectacular Jumping Crocodile Cruise travellers can view elusive, powerful crocodiles in their natural habitat. The friendly crew discuss crocodile survival skills, important for a Northern Territory adventure. In 1971 the Australian saltwater crocodile, believed to be facing extinction, was declared a protected species. Today increased numbers of saltwater crocodiles roam the waterways of the Northern Territory.
A large collection of python snakes are on display at the kiosk. Try holding one if you dare.
